Transaction 2eac77163655617fc3c2cf56b4153e40d64363cbb0462a6ae2bc9bfec6065e5f
1 Input
1 Output
-
2eac77163655617fc3c2cf56b4153e40d64363cbb0462a6ae2bc9bfec6065e5f:0
- value
- 8087874
- script pubkey
- OP_0 OP_PUSHBYTES_20 44181a31c7c1a10489352d20836d87fea7aa690b
- address
- bc1qgsvp5vw8cxssfzf495sgxmv8l6n656gtd6q2jf